The Illinois Department of Transportation (IDOT) has announced that Illinois Route 1 will be closed starting late next week for the removal of a bridge over an abandoned railroad line. The bridge is located between 11th and 12th Streets in the city of Mt Carmel and according to IDOT officials has concluded it’s life cycle. Rather than building a new bridge, it was determined to be more cost efficient to replace the existing bridge structure with a road. That move saves costs long-term and require less time for Route 1 to be closed to vehicular traffic. A detour will be posted utilizing North Market Street/College Drive and 1550th Boulevard. Only local traffic will be permitted on Route 1 in the project area during the road closure. Work will get underway Thursday June 30th and is anticipated to be completed by mid-August.
